Select an object that is under other objects and cycle forward through the stack of objects. Tab after you select the top object. Select an object that is under other objects and cycle backward through the stack of objects. Shift+Tab after you select the top object. Select multiple shapes.

WebIn addition, online forms contain controls. Controls are objects that display data or make it easier for users to enter or edit data, perform an action, or make a selection. In general, controls make the form easier to use. Examples of common controls include list boxes, option buttons, and command buttons. Controls can also run assigned macros ...
